England vs Pakistan 2nd Test Day 1: Key Highlights and Moments at Lord’s

Introduction: A Classic Lord’s Encounter

Day 1 of the England vs Pakistan 2nd Test at Lord’s delivered a captivating blend of top-order resilience and incisive bowling spells. With both sides aiming to take control in the five-day duel, cricket fans across India tuned in for match excitement and compelling sports action. From elegant drives to clever seam movement, this opening day set the stage for a closely fought contest.

England’s Solid Start with the Bat

Winning the toss and electing to bat first, the hosts were keen to build a commanding total on a pitch offering some early seam. Opener Zak Crawley showed intent, using the depth of the crease to drive through the covers. Though he departed in the 30s, Joe Root anchored the innings with his trademark composure. Root’s front-foot play and sharp placement kept the scoreboard ticking as he weathered Pakistan’s new-ball threat.

Captain Ben Stokes joined Root, and the pair forged an 80-plus partnership that steadied England after early jitters. Stokes, displaying his range of strokes, pressured the fielders with crisp cuts and powerful pulls. When he fell just short of a half-century, the Lord’s crowd applauded his contribution to the match excitement.

Pakistan’s Seam Attack Bites Back

Pakistan’s fast bowlers showcased their skill at exploiting lateral movement. Naseem Shah extracted bounce and swing, troubling both openers with searing deliveries. Shaheen Afridi struck a vital blow when he trapped Crawley lbw, shifting momentum in Pakistan’s favour. Young Mir Hamza impressed later, varying his lengths and angles to snag a couple of lower-order wickets.

Babar Azam Leads the Fightback

In their first innings of the day, Pakistan’s batting lineup faced a lively home attack led by Olly Stone and Mark Wood. Early breakthroughs saw Pakistan pegged back at 40 for 2, but skipper Babar Azam held firm. His precise footwork and penchant for piercing gaps injected much-needed stability. Babar’s classy cover drives and sharp singles helped rebuild the innings alongside Azhar Ali, who showed grit in defence.

Just as Pakistan looked to gain ascendancy, Wood produced a stunning spell, knocking back Azhar’s off stump. A couple of run-outs courtesy of agile fielding kept the scoreboard in check, and by stumps the tourists were 120 for 5, still trailing England’s first-innings total.
